Concrete Foundation Types

Concrete foundations play an essential role in the durability and long-term integrity of all structures, as they provide the necessary support for the complete structure. A number of key types of concrete foundations are available, each suited to different soil conditions and structural needs. The most common types include slab foundations, which feature one continuous, thick layer of concrete; crawl space foundations, which lift buildings above the ground surface; and basement foundations, which supply supplementary living space and storage areas. Each option presents its own set of benefits, such as ease of construction, cost-effectiveness, or enhanced insulation. Understanding these variations is vital for identifying the suitable foundation that aligns with the specific requirements of the project, ensuring a solid base for any construction endeavor.

Value Of Adequate Reinforcement

Reinforcement functions as a critical component in securing the durability and strength of concrete foundations. Proper reinforcement techniques, such as the use of steel rebar or fibrous materials, strengthen the overall structural soundness by providing tensile strength that concrete alone lacks. This combination effectively mitigates the risk of cracking and structural failure under various loads and environmental conditions. Moreover, adequate reinforcement allows for better stress distribution throughout the foundation structure, supporting overall performance and longevity. Professionals must evaluate elements including soil conditions and load requirements when developing reinforcement strategies. By prioritizing proper reinforcement, homeowners can protect their investments and ensure the foundations are equipped to withstand the test of time, providing effective support for the entire building.

Approaches To Foundation Repair

Foundation repair methods serve a critical purpose in preserving the stability of buildings, especially when problems stem from insufficient reinforcement or environmental conditions. Common methods include underpinning, a process that reinforces the foundation by reaching deeper into solid ground, and slab jacking, where a mixture is injected beneath concrete slabs to lift and level them. Another technique is helical piers, which are installed to provide support in unstable soil conditions. Furthermore, wall anchors are capable of steadying bowed walls by reallocating structural pressures. Each method is tailored to specific problems, ensuring effective remediation and prolonging the lifespan of the structure. Comprehensive analysis by skilled specialists is vital to selecting the best approach for a successful foundation repair outcome.

Cutting-Edge Techniques in Decorative Concrete Finishes

Turning conventional surfaces into remarkable works of art, cutting-edge approaches in decorative concrete finishes have become increasingly favored among architects and designers. These techniques improve visual appeal while delivering durability and functionality. Techniques such as stamping, staining, and engraving allow for a wide range of textures and colors, replicating materials like stone or wood without the related upkeep expenses.

Stenciling offers elaborate designs, allowing personalized patterns that can transform any area. Additionally, the use of exposed aggregate showcases distinctive stone arrangements, contributing a natural aesthetic to all surfaces.

New innovations, including the introduction of environmentally sustainable pigments and sealers, have further supported the eco-conscious nature of ornamental concrete surfaces. With the adoption of state-of-the-art technology, industry experts can achieve bold colors and long-lasting performance.

How to Maintain and Care for Your Concrete Installations

Upon hiring a experienced concrete specialist, looking after your concrete work is essential to guarantee their long-term integrity. Frequent upkeep is key; contaminants and marks need to be eliminated immediately to prevent surface degradation. A careful pressure washing can effectively eliminate buildup and contaminants without causing damage.

Waterproofing concrete surfaces periodically is essential to prevent moisture infiltration and staining. This strengthens the surface while enhancing its overall appearance. During winter months, the use of de-icing agents is not recommended, as they can cause cracks and surface flaking.

Cracks should be addressed immediately with the proper repair compounds to stop further degradation. Additionally, excessive weight should be controlled to eliminate excessive pressure on the concrete surface. By implementing these care routines, property managers can rest assured their concrete installations remain durable and visually appealing for the long term.

How Long Does Concrete Typically Last Before Needing Repairs?

Concrete commonly survives 30 to 40 years on average before requiring repairs, based on factors including environmental conditions, quality of materials, and maintenance practices. Routine inspections help prolong its lifespan and catch problems early.

Can Concrete Be Repurposed After Its Useful Life?

Indeed, concrete may be recycled after its useful life. It is frequently broken down and reused as aggregate in new concrete productions or utilized in various construction projects, thereby lowering environmental waste and sustaining valuable resources.

In What Ways Do Weather Conditions Influence Concrete Curing Times?

Weather conditions greatly influence concrete curing times. High temperatures accelerate evaporation, while cold temperatures may slow down the hardening process. Humidity also plays a role, with an overabundance of moisture risking the development of surface problems, ultimately impacting the strength and longevity of the concrete.
